Ranking Member Robert Garcia Demands Pam Bondi Stop the White House Epstein Cover-Up; Explain Maxwell Prison Transfer
Washington, D.C. — Today, Rep. Robert Garcia, Ranking Member of the Committee on Oversight and Government Reform, demanded Attorney General Pam Bondi end her efforts to obstruct the Committee’s investigation into Jeffrey Epstein and cease the White House cover-up of Epstein’s connections to wealthy and powerful individuals.
For months, Attorney General Bondi has refused to comply with the Oversight Committee’s lawful congressional subpoena to release the full Epstein files, and must cooperate with the Committee’s investigation into a corrupt quid-quo-pro between the DOJ and Ghislaine Maxwell. This comes after the Department of Justice has refused to provide additional production from the Epstein files or share details about the full scope of Epstein-related materials in its possession, and has failed to respond to the Committee’s investigation into preferential treatment for convicted sex offender Ghislaine Maxwell.
